WebbAs the personification of freedom, it’s hardly surprising that Libertas became the patron goddess of freed slaves. Everyone in Rome recognized and honored that patronage too, not just the slaves themselves. According to Roman tradition, when a master was to grant a slave his or her freedom, they went to the Temple of Liberty in Rome. WebbCupid, ancient Roman god of love in all its varieties, the counterpart of the Greek god Eros and the equivalent of Amor in Latin poetry. According to myth, Cupid was the son of Mercury, the winged messenger of the gods, and Venus, the goddess of love.
